Videos - downloading • Right-click on the download icon. • Save Target As… • Choose location to save to (My Videos, Discovery Education - streaming is a good place). • Rename it so you will recognize it later. • Later, when you want to play it, double-click it and Windows Media Player will open and begin playing it.

  11. Right-click on the download icon. Save Target As… Choose location to save to (My Videos, Discovery Education - streaming is a good place). Rename it so you will recognize it later. BE SURE to add .avi as the extension at the end of the filename. Videos – download for use with Movie Maker

  12. Terms of Use • You must maintain the original intent of the video. With the exception of the video titles that have been identified as “editable content,” you may not shorten any clip, edit sound, or add images within that clip. • “Users may edit videos and video clips designated on the Website as editable, solely in connection with classroom or other school-related projects.”

  13. Citations • Examples of proper citation format for video and image are as follows: • MLA Example for Video:Danny and the Dinosaur. By Syd Hoff. Weston Woods, 1990. Discovery Enterprises, LLC. 30 Nov. 2001 <http://www.unitedstreaming.com> • MLA Example for an Image:Name of the Image. By Paul Fuqua. 2003. Discovery Enterprises, LLC. 01 Jan. 2003 < http://www.unitedstreaming.com> • Other examples of proper citation for K-12 schools can be found at http://www.landmark-project.com/citation_machine/index.php.

  17. Pros Very easy to use Simple controls Free Already on your XP computer Lots of transitions and effects Cons Can’t burn directly to DVD (Vista includes DVD Maker) Few options for titles and credits Movie Maker Capabilities

  18. Import Videos • Import Video • Remember, videos saved from Discovery Education - streaming must be saved as .avi • Choose folder and file to import • Decide to allow Movie Maker to create clips or not • Clips are smaller portions of the file for easier management

  19. Import Pictures • Import pictures • Browse to your pictures • Use Ctrl + click to select more than one file at a time • Drag to storyboard or timeline

  24. Right-click on music/audio track to fade, change volume, etc. Movie Maker can record your narration if desired. Music/Audio

  25. These effects change the way your clip looks all the way through the clip. You can “stack” effects, but they may cancel each other out. Video Effects

  26. The storyboard view shows effects and transitions better than timeline. An effect has been applied when there is a blue star on the lower left corner of the clip. Right-click the star to add or remove effects. Video Effects

  27. Transitions control how the transition between clips happens. These icons show between the clips on the storyboard. Video Transitions

  28. These are your only choices. You can change the font, color, and animation only. Credits will scroll at the end of the movie. Titles/Credits

  29. These Tips are available from the Help menu to assist you in these areas. Hints and Tips

  30. Be sure to save the project in order to edit later. The project keeps your settings. The movie can’t easily be edited without the project file. Save Project

  31. Save to My Computer Makes movie using best settings for playback on a computer Save to CD Makes movie and automatically burns to CD if the computer is equipped with a burner. Send in e-mail Automatically saves in a small enough format to be sent in an email. Send to the Web Allows you to choose format Send to DV camera Save to camcorder Finishing

  32. Finishing • Be sure to take the project file, along with all the files that you imported. • It’s a good idea to save all files to be used in a project in the same folder. Save the project there, also, and everything will be in one place. • Consider uploading your movie to TeacherTube.com if other teachers might find it useful.
